  • Patent number: 11379023
    Abstract: Examples are disclosed that relate to methods, computing devices, and head-mounted display (HMD) devices for regulating a surface temperature of a device. In one example, a method comprises determining the surface temperature of a surface of the device, determining an energy accumulator value indicating cumulative energy received by a user via the surface of the device, and using a dynamic temperature limit function to calculate a temperature limit as a function of the energy accumulator value. The method also comprises comparing the surface temperature to the temperature limit. When the surface temperature has not reached the temperature limit, the method comprises incrementing the energy accumulator value. When the surface temperature has reached the temperature limit, the method comprises initiating a thermal mitigation action to cool the surface.

  • Patent number: 11235506
    Abstract: A method and a molding station for producing containers filled with a liquid filling material from preforms made of a thermoplastic material. Thermally conditioned preforms are molded into containers and filled with the liquid filling material, which is supplied to the preforms under pressure as a pressure medium in a multi-part mold of a molding station. The mold is movable from a closed state into an open state in order to repeatedly supply a preform and subsequently remove a completely molded and filled container. Molding of the preform into the container is performed against the mold inner wall when the mold is in the closed state. Liquid is removed from the mold between temporally successive supplying processes starting with the conversion of the mold from the closed state into the open state. A working wheel including such molding stations, and a device including such a working wheel are also disclosed.

  • Patent number: 11027477
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for producing a container (2) filled with a liquid product in which a preform (1) consisting of a thermoplastic material is stretched after a thermal conditioning with a stretching rod (11) and is shaped in an inflation process to the container (2), wherein the inflation process comprises a pre-blowing phase in which a fluid of a first pressure level is used for the inflation, and comprises a main blowing phase in which a fluid of a second pressure level that is greater than the first pressure level is used for the inflation and is characterized in that the fluid used in the pre-blowing phase is a blowing gas and that the fluid used in the main blowing phase is the product. Furthermore, the invention relates to a device for carrying out a method according to the invention.
